HTML本身并不能识别中文,它只是一种标记语言,用于创建网页的结构和内容,我们可以通过一些方法来确保中文在HTML中的正确显示和处理,以下是一些建议和方法:
1. 使用正确的字符编码
在HTML文档的<head>
部分,我们需要设置正确的字符编码,以确保浏览器能够正确解析中文字符,通常,我们会使用UTF8
编码,因为它支持多种语言,包括中文。
<!DOCTYPE html> <html> <head> <meta charset="UTF8"> <title>中文示例</title> </head> <body> <p>这是一个中文段落。</p> </body> </html>
2. 使用中文字体
为了让中文字符在网页上正确显示,我们需要使用支持中文的字体,可以使用CSS为中文文本设置字体。
<!DOCTYPE html> <html> <head> <meta charset="UTF8"> <style> .chinesetext { fontfamily: "Microsoft YaHei", Arial, sansserif; } </style> </head> <body> <p class="chinesetext">这是一个中文段落。</p> </body> </html>
3. 避免使用英文字符间距和对齐方式
由于中文字符的宽度和英文字符不同,我们需要特别注意字符间距和对齐方式,可以使用CSS调整中文文本的样式。
<!DOCTYPE html> <html> <head> <meta charset="UTF8"> <style> .chinesetext { fontfamily: "Microsoft YaHei", Arial, sansserif; letterspacing: normal; textalign: justify; } </style> </head> <body> <p class="chinesetext">这是一个中文段落。</p> </body> </html>
4. 使用中文标点符号
在输入中文文本时,确保使用中文标点符号,而不是英文标点符号,使用中文逗号(,)而不是英文逗号(,)。
虽然HTML本身不能识别中文,但通过使用正确的字符编码、字体和CSS样式,我们可以确保中文在HTML中的正确显示和处理。
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。
评论(0)